What is Esports Betting?

Esports betting is similar to traditional sports betting, where fans can place wagers on the outcome of matches or tournaments. Instead of betting on physical sports like football or basketball, esports betting allows fans to bet on video game competitions. Whether you're a fan of first-person shooters, real-time strategy games, or multiplayer online battle arenas, there is a game and a betting market for you.

How Does Online Esports Betting Work?

Online esports betting works much like traditional online sports betting. Fans can visit online sportsbooks that offer esports betting markets and place bets on their favorite teams or players. These bets can range from simple moneyline bets on the winner of a match to more complex prop bets on things like total kills or objectives scored.

Before placing a bet, fans should research the teams and players involved in the match, as well as any relevant statistics or trends. It's also important to understand the odds and how they are calculated, as this will help fans make more informed betting decisions.

Popular Esports Betting Markets

There are a variety of esports games and competitions that fans can bet on, with some of the most popular betting markets including:

  • Match Winner: Betting on the winner of a single match.
  • Outright Winner: Betting on the winner of an entire tournament or league.
  • Prop Bets: Betting on specific outcomes within a match, such as first blood or total number of kills.
  • Handicap Betting: Betting on a team to win with a handicap advantage or disadvantage.
